Family Dispute Turns Fatal in Karnataka’s Shivamogga

IO_AdminAfrica10 hours ago7 Views

Rapid Summary

  • A man named Janardhana, 26, was allegedly assaulted on Wednesday and succumbed to his injuries at a private hospital in Shivamogga on Thursday.
  • Janardhana was a resident of Bannikodu and worked at a hotel near the APMC yard in Shivamogga.
  • The attack reportedly occurred at Janardhana’s workplace and involved one of his relatives, identified as Hanumanthu.
  • Hanumanthu allegedly used lethal weapons during the assault.
  • Vinoba Nagara Police have registered a case and arrested Hanumanthu in connection with the incident.
